    Position Overview

    We are seeking an experienced Controls Engineer to join our automation team, providing technical leadership, mentorship, and hands-on design of advanced machine control systems. This role combines project ownership, team leadership, and direct customer engagement to deliver safe, high-quality automated equipment.

    Roles & Responsibilities

    • Manage time efficiently and continually improve personal work performance

    • Prioritize and coordinate competing project demands to meet milestones and deadlines

    • Promote and apply safety-conscious design and build processes

    •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to deliver projects on time and within budget

    • Maintain a positive, professional attitude toward team members and customers

    • Communicate effectively with team members, management, and customers regarding project progress and potential issues

    • Assign tasks to team members and ensure project milestones are met

    • Develop bills of material (BOMs) and provide technical project guidance and support

    • Design, implement, and install machine controls and interfaces for automated equipment, including:

      • Safety systems

      • PLCs and HMIs

      • Peripheral devices

      • MES systems

      • PC-based logic

    • Lead controls package design for medium and large machines, ensuring packages are safe, accurate, and meet project scope

    • Design electrical and pneumatic schematics

    • Interpret mechanical design drawings to define electrical requirements

    • Troubleshoot and resolve hardware and software issues

    • Mentor team members to continually raise departmental expertise

    • Lead the controls team during customer site visits, including installation, startup, and training

    • Travel to customer sites as required

    • Perform other duties as assigned to support project and business needs

    Qualifications & Education

    • High School Diploma or equivalent (required)

    • Preferred: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ical, Electrical, Computer Engineering, or related field

    • 5+ years of engineering experience designing or troubleshooting automated equipment

    • Intermediate proficiency in robotic integration, vision systems, and peripheral handshaking

    • Intermediate to expert proficiency in PLC / ladder logic programming

    • Intermediate to expert proficiency in CAD software

    • Intermediate to expert proficiency in electrical and pneumatic design

    • Intermediate to expert proficiency in programming/software languages

    • Strong troubleshooting skills for hardware and software issues
